UW-Rock County: Math refresher course eases college transition for returning adults

Janesville – Adults considering a college education who want to polish rusty math skills before taking a placement test can register for a non-credit basic math refresher course through the UW-Rock County Office of Continuing Education. The course meets on the campus at 2909 Kellogg Ave. at the following times: Tuesday, March 3, 6:30-8:30 p.m.; Thursday, March 5, 6:30-8:30 p.m.; Saturday, March 7, 9-11 a.m.; Tuesday, March 10, 6:30-8:30 p.m.; Thursday, March 12, 6:30-8:30 p.m.; and Saturday, March 14, 9-11 a.m.

The course will be taught by UW-Rock County math instructor Carol Roy, who will cover fractions, decimals, percentages, integers, basic equations and basic geometry. The course is designed to ease math anxiety and help new or returning adults students feel more confident about taking the math placement test necessary to register for credit courses at the campus.
